Transaction 2671c3f899fcc0233474e4dd82f563c148dc125cad6e7ce0bd2b3f7cf9de9b84

3 Input
2 Outputs
  • 2671c3f899fcc0233474e4dd82f563c148dc125cad6e7ce0bd2b3f7cf9de9b84:0
  • value  2948612
    address  3HcZiWjgrHT3oEqqVdmHyMbpUkAeTyYNpX
  • 2671c3f899fcc0233474e4dd82f563c148dc125cad6e7ce0bd2b3f7cf9de9b84:1
  • value  24321432
    address  3Hh7WzXQSiVmqj2xMqkeGF2rhfad88MprG